Folks searching for a car at the moment could save money by purchasing a brand new versus a used car for sale, at least in the USA. A contemporary analysis by the well-liked car website Edmunds.Com exhibits that purchasing a new car can be considerably less expensive than an equal older model. The investment perceptibly relies on the car you plan to obtain and your financial classification.

The preceding year has witnessed a big abatement in car sales in the USA with larger car producers needing federal aid to endure the fiscal troubles. In spite of the generous bulks of cash being administered in crisis credit and the cash for clunkers incentive, new and used car sales declined in the preceding year. In spite of the most important selling cars in the United States remaining almost consistent, many car producers advancing low-cost new cars acquired a significant portion of the car market.

In a bid to achieve market share numerous key car makers are proposing newer vehicles at much abated rates and in selected instances actually less than the comparable vehicles offered the year before. This comprises cars and personal trucks by titans like Mazda. As reported by the comparison, one of the most important factors for this build up has been because of a modest inventory of used cars.

Numerous car buyers have been deferring the sale of their cars because of the decline and in spite of a huge interest for used cars on sale, a dearth of quantity has caused a climb in rates. The funds for clunkers drive also helped some vehicles rendering alternative used cars impracticable. The distinct logic quoted was the declining demand for leasing cars.

Purchasers can nonetheless profit from this condition if their financial appraisal warrants them to attain credit at reduced interest charges for an regular time of five years. Supplementary federal and area abatement moreover have to be accounted for to attain a final assessment ahead of deciding on precise used cars for sale. The difference in the end also has to do with the sale cost of a used car and its capacity to maintain a fine second hand rate.

It would be intelligent for buyers to reserve adequate time and deliberately work out the exclusive rate of both the latest and used car on sale and exhibit a bit of adjustability in choosing a certain car style. In the end you barely get to procure new cars that are more economical than alike used cars on sale. This is an admirable prospect not to be blotched by purchasers aiming for a car.
